What's the gist?

Micah Lasher campaigns on abolishing ICE while his wife earns millions from companies that contract with the immigration enforcement agency, drawing accusations of hypocrisy in the Manhattan congressional primary.

Context

Jerry Nadler announced his retirement from Congress, triggering a competitive Democratic primary in Manhattan's 12th district. Lasher, a former Nadler aide and current assemblyman, emerged as a frontrunner alongside several other candidates.
